UW System regents approve a 5.5% tuition hike
The 17-1 vote, with Regent John Drew of Milwaukee opposing, followed a lengthy debate about whether further belt-tightening could occur instead of a 5.5% tuition increase for a sixth consecutive year.
A 5.5% tuition increase is “very arbitrary because it’s the maximum allowed,” Dylan Jambrek, a recent UW-Eau Claire graduate and vice president of the United Council of UW Students, said after the regents approved the increase.
“If there was no cap, it would probably be a higher number,” said Jambrek, who sat near the front of the meeting room and was not holding a protest sign.
